Cisco slaps down MDS death rumor

Cisco today took the unusual step of commenting on rumor. In a blog posting by Omar Sultan in Cisco's data center blog, Sultan shot down apparent rumors circulating that Cisco is dropping its MDS director switches. Sultan writes: "... this may just be wishful thinking on the part of some folks, the reality is that Cisco is fully committed to the MDS family. The MDS continues to be a successful and critical part of our Data Center 3.0 strategy and we will continue to invest in the platform. End of story."

Sultan also writes that Cisco "switching competitors in May started telling customers that our Catalyst switch was going to be put out to pasture, which, of course, was not even close to reality."
